Door Hinge Repair in Kansas City, KS
Door hinge repair services address issues related to the hinges that connect doors to their frames, ensuring smooth operation and proper alignment. This type of service covers a variety of projects, including fixing squeaky hinges, realigning misaligned doors, replacing worn or broken hinges, and restoring functionality to both interior and exterior doors. Property owners often seek this service when doors become difficult to open or close, sag, or develop gaps that compromise security or energy efficiency.
Before requesting door hinge repair, homeowners should consider the type of hinges involved, the extent of the damage or misalignment, and whether the hinges are standard or specialized (such as heavy-duty or decorative hinges). Understanding the condition of the hinges and the desired outcome can help determine if repairs are sufficient or if hinge replacement might be necessary. Clear communication about the specific issues experienced can assist in achieving the best results for door functionality and security.

Common Door Hinge Repair Jobs
Door hinge repair - restores proper door alignment and smooth operation.
Hinge replacement - replaces worn or damaged hinges to improve security and function.
Hinge lubrication - reduces squeaks and prevents sticking for easier door movement.
Hinge tightening - secures loose hinges to prevent door sagging or misalignment.
Hinge installation - adds new hinges to support door upgrades or renovations.
Hinge adjustment - fine-tunes door positioning for proper closure and fit.
Door Hinge Repair Questions
What are common signs that a door hinge needs repair? Squeaking sounds, misalignment, difficulty opening or closing, and sagging are typical indicators that hinges may require attention.
Can damaged hinges affect door security? Yes, compromised hinges can make doors less secure and more vulnerable to forced entry or accidental damage.
What types of hinge repairs are typically needed? Repairs often include replacing worn or broken hinges, realigning misaligned hinges, or lubricating squeaky hinges for smoother operation.
Is it possible to prevent hinge issues on exterior doors? Regular maintenance like lubrication and checking for wear can help prevent common hinge problems on exterior doors.
